What Are Cookies
Cookies are small text files that websites place on your device when you visit them. They serve various purposes, from remembering your preferences to understanding how you use the site. Most websites use cookies to improve user experience and gather analytics data.
Cookies contain information that is transferred to your device's hard drive or memory. They typically include a unique identifier, the website name, and some numbers and characters. When you return to the website, cookies allow it to recognize your device.

Do Not Track Signals
Some browsers include a "Do Not Track" feature that signals to websites you visit that you do not want your online activity tracked. Currently, there is no universal standard for how websites should respond to these signals. We do not alter our data collection practices in response to Do Not Track signals, but you can use our cookie preferences to control tracking.
Web Beacons and Pixels
In addition to cookies, we may use web beacons (also known as tracking pixels) in our emails and on our website. These are small transparent images that help us understand user behavior, such as whether an email was opened or which pages are most popular. Web beacons work in conjunction with cookies and can be disabled by refusing cookies or disabling images in your email client.

Cookie Retention
Different cookies have different retention periods:
- Session cookies: Deleted when you close your browser
- Persistent cookies: Remain on your device for a specified period or until you delete them manually
